Woops, almost finished this tube of Kiehl's Richly Hydrating Hand Cream so here's a quick review. Can you guess why this tube in the Coriander scent is the last to be used? What an odd scent for a hand cream, right?




I already reviewed these hand creams in detailed so I'm going straight for the scent.
- Coriander: one look at this and I thought, hmm, I'm not sure about this. So I kept picking something else over it. Finally, I started using it because I just wanted to get it over with, not exactly an inspired pick. It's a sweet herbal fragrance that only faintly reminiscent of coriander. Still, I don't love the scent and neither does hubby, so I won't repurchase.
